“In the late 1960s for a very short period of time Mercury toys were painted and assembled in Arica Chile for domestic consumption. These toys often had differences from the standard Italian models, odd variations in colours, shades & details; they are without question the rarest of all Mercury toys".
This Chilean version of the Mercury Ferrari model is finished in deep red (unlike the standard issue which is a lighter shade of red), intact racing numbers ‘186’, undamaged windscreen, blue plastic driver (and unlike the standard issue, the driver’s helmet is unpainted), jewelled lights (and unlike the standard version, the light recess is body colour not silver). Detailed cast wheels are finished in gold (unique to the Chilean version). Metal base is unpainted. Screwed base.
Opening boot with spare wheel. Silver rear light detail and number plate.
Few small marks away from mint.
Lovely, colourfully illustrated card box is clean, fresh and bright. Light wear. Note the Chilean stamp “ARMADO EN ARICA” on an end flap and on one non-picture side:
